Plot

Preparation

"Build poetry detection device": The poetry detection device is a combination of mirrors and lights that are mounted on the shoes of the players. Some players will wear mirrors, others will wear lights. Get round mirrors of ca. 20mm diameter, velcro and duct tape, headlights.

  • Apply duct tape around the outline of the mirror (mostly for security reasons to prevent injuries by the sharp edge).
  • Apply velcro band on the mirrors backs that they can be mounted on shoes. Two mountings per mirror will do.
  • Apply velcro band on the headlights that they can be mounted on shoes.

"Build poetry lines": Take the poems provided in this description or choose a lovely poem of a similar length. Use florescent self-adhesive band to write single lines on it. For this you need to cut the florescent band in pieces according to the length of the poem lines, and write the poem lines on them in REVERSE WRITING (as it will be read out with a mirror).

Stick the poem lines on the self-adhesive band on the bottom side of benches. In dark the florescent band and the writing will become visible if players charge it using the headlights mounted on their shoes. After that players equipped with a mirror can place their feet under the bench in order to read the glowing line of poetry.

Each team gets a poetry expert assigned to. Each poetry expert needs a clipboard with the complete poems on it.

Before starting, build teams of about 3-5 players. Within the team, hand out 2 mirrors and a headlight (you might want to assist in mounting them on the players shoes). Hand out 2 walkie-talkies in each team and to the the poetry expert assigned to the team. Make sure that the walkie-talkies within a team are set to the same channel and that the poetry expert is using the same channel too.
